David Harris presents a two-part series for AJC Academy on the Soviet Jewry movement, one of the most successful human rights campaigns in modern history. Part 1, on Wednesday (3/25), focuses on the decades-long struggle to let Jews emigrate. Part 2, focuses on what happened to the nearly two million people who emigrated. David was active in the campaign for many years, and was the only Russian-speaking American activist who had unique vantage points from Moscow, Leningrad, Vienna, Rome, Washington, New York, and Jerusalem.
